Placements: Most of the students pursue higher education, but the CRC department of Amity University Mumbai (AUM) provides the forms for placements. As per the requirement, companies approach AUM and students, on the basis of their skills, get selected. The type of placement could be an internship or a job. Companies such as Kotak approach AUM for HR trainee posts. The stipend can depend on the level of experience and knowledge of the individual as well as their position in the company. The college had good placement, diverse campus crowd, and good infrastructure.

Placements: More than 200 companies were part of the campus placement drive. Around 70-80% of students in our batch were placed and satisfied. Apart from companies like Capgemini, Accenture, Cognizant, Infosys, etc., big companies like Goldmann Sachs, JP Morgan, Amazon, etc., were also recruited. The top salary package offered was 20 LPA and the average salary package offered was around 4 LPA.

In this college, everything is fine but the faculty members are not very good.

Placements: Almost every student has been placed. The highest salary package offered is 12 LPA. The average salary package offered ranges from 5 LPA - 6 LPA. The lowest salary package offered is 4 LPA. The top recruiting companies are Tata Edge, Quinnox, DXC, Cognizant, Wipro, etc. Some students get internships in companies like Vodafone, Solar Labs, etc. The top roles offered are software trainees, etc.
